Course Objective

With this course, the students in the functioning of the human body in order to understand the mechanisms and principles of the operation of instruments used is to learn the basic concepts of physics.

Learning Outcomes of the Course Unit

1   The basic concepts of physics define work-energy and power concepts and units
2   Measurement unit conversion and unit systems, the ability to recognize and apply units.
3   Behavior and properties of fluids, fluid pressure can explain.
4   Chemical structure of the solution, the solution, the mixture explain the concepts of the compound.
5   Static electricity, electric field, potential and potential concepts
6   Electric current, resistance, electromotive explain the concepts.
7   Explain the effect of magnetism and magnetic current.
8   How they are constructed and the properties of electromagnetic waves

Course Contents

Week Subject Description
1 Measurement and Unit systems
2 physical Quantities
3 Work-Energy and Power
4 Properties of Matter
5 Fluid
6 Static electricity
7 Electric Current and Resistance-I
8 Electric Current and Resistance-II
9 magnetism
10 Magnetic effect of the current I
11 Alternating Currents
12 Hertzian waves
